An institute is a specialized organization for education or research, while a university is a larger institution offering undergraduate and graduate degrees.
Institute vs. University

Key Differences

An institute typically specializes in a particular field or area of study, offering targeted education and training. Conversely, a university is a comprehensive institution that provides a wider range of academic disciplines, offering both undergraduate and postgraduate programs.

Institutes often focus on specific vocational or technical training, sometimes not offering full degree programs. Universities, however, award bachelor's, master's, and doctoral degrees across various fields, embodying a broader educational spectrum.

Institutes may engage in focused research within their specialized fields, contributing to specific industries or technologies. Universities are known for their extensive research capabilities, covering a diverse array of subjects and contributing to general and specialized knowledge.

Institutes are generally smaller in size and may have more limited facilities compared to universities. Universities are typically larger, with extensive campuses that include a variety of facilities like libraries, laboratories, and sports complexes.

Institutes and universities may differ in their governance structures and accreditation processes. While institutes can be part of a university or independent, universities are autonomous institutions often recognized by national educational authorities.

University

An institution organized and incorporated for the purpose of imparting instruction, examining students, and otherwise promoting education in the higher branches of literature, science, art, etc., empowered to confer degrees in the several arts and faculties, as in theology, law, medicine, music, etc. A university may exist without having any college connected with it, or it may consist of but one college, or it may comprise an assemblage of colleges established in any place, with professors for instructing students in the sciences and other branches of learning. In modern usage, a university is expected to have both an undergraduate division, granting bachelor's degrees, and a graduate division, granting master's or doctoral degrees, but there are some exceptions. In addition, a modern university typically also supports research by its faculty
The present universities of Europe were, originally, the greater part of them, ecclesiastical corporations, instituted for the education of churchmen . . . What was taught in the greater part of those universities was suitable to the end of their institutions, either theology or something that was merely preparatory to theology.
